The MMA world has been buzzing after a fiery sparring session between rising light-weight Denis Frimpong and UFC star Paddy Pimblett. The unsanctioned showdown happened at Frimpong’s Manchester fitness center and stemmed from a social media feud however ended with each fighters shaking arms. Now, Frimpong has opened up concerning the encounter, shedding mild on the occasions that led to it and his perspective on the end result.

Denis Frimpong vs. Paddy Pimblett Sparring

Chatting with us in an unique interview, Frimpong defined that he was initially unaware of any animosity between himself and Paddy Pimblett. “I really thought we had been cool, to be trustworthy. I by no means thought we had any beef,” he stated. Frimpong attributed the stress to feedback he made throughout a filming of Oktagon Problem, which concerned one other fighter, George Staines. “Paddy clearly took some problem to that… I suppose he’s like the large brother of their fitness center. And though me and George don’t have any points anymore… Paddy clearly had some problem with that.”

The state of affairs escalated when Pimblett challenged Frimpong to a sparring match, promising to “come as much as your fitness center and batter you.” Frimpong responded with a video that gained traction on-line, setting the stage for his or her face-off.

Regardless of the heated buildup, Frimpong emphasised that the session was performed in a managed ambiance with mutual respect. “We organized it, bought right into a managed atmosphere, had our honest play… Had a knock, you realize, after which shook arms afterward,” he stated. “And I believe that’s how, as males, that’s how our issues ought to be sorted out.”

The sparring session itself was intense, with Paddy Pimblett finally securing a rear-naked choke that compelled Denis Frimpong to faucet out a number of occasions earlier than the maintain was launched. Nonetheless, Frimpong believes the expertise was invaluable for his improvement as a fighter. “I believe I gained that complete state of affairs as a result of… I bought to check out my degree towards somebody of that caliber,” he stated. “I bought to see the place the holes are… and everybody’s speaking about it now, so everybody’s going to have eyes on my subsequent battle.” Which is booked for Oktagon 68.

Did Paddy Maintain The Choke Too Lengthy?

Denis Frimpong additionally addressed the controversy surrounding Paddy Pimblett’s refusal to right away launch the chokehold. In response to him, the phrases of the sparring session had been clear from the outset: “It was agreed upon in textual content earlier than the battle really began… We go till somebody quits, principally.”

Whereas acknowledging the dangers concerned, Frimpong stated he was ready for such depth. “In my head, I knew that if he bought a choke on, he was going to try to choke me unconscious… So far as going to sleep from a choke, I’m not arsed about it.” Regardless of the bodily toll of the sparring match and its heated moments, Frimpong stays optimistic concerning the expertise and its affect on his profession. “Yeah, [Pimblett] gained the precise spar,” he admitted. “However I bought to get in there and have a tough spar… with a high 15 man in my weight division within the UFC.”

For Denis Frimpong, this chance examined his abilities and raised his profile forward of his subsequent battle. As for his relationship with Paddy Pimblett shifting ahead? The Irish fighter appears content material with how issues ended: “We every had our folks there… Had a knock… shook arms afterward, and that’s it.” Whether or not this marks the top of their rivalry or simply one other chapter stays to be seen, however one factor is evident, Denis Frimpong is prepared for no matter comes subsequent.
